Вопрос задан 24.03.2025 в 10:28. Предмет Информатика. Спрашивает Пантелеева Анна.

Игральный кубик бросается три раза (выпадает три случайных значения). Из этих чисел составляется целое число, программа должна найти его квадрат.
Пример:

Выпало очков:

1 2 3

Число: 123

Его квадрат: 15129

Перейти к ответам

Ответы на вопрос

Отвечает Севостьянов Данил.

Задача, которую вы описали, заключается в том, чтобы при трёх бросках игрального кубика собрать числа, полученные на каждом броске, в одно целое число, а затем найти квадрат этого числа.

Давайте разберём, как это можно сделать пошагово:

  1. Сначала бросаем кубик три раза. Пусть выпали такие значения: 1, 2, 3.

  2. Составляем из этих чисел одно целое число. То есть, мы должны склеить эти значения в строку и затем преобразовать её в число. В примере это будет:

    • 1, 2, 3 → строка "123" → число 123.
  3. Вычисляем квадрат этого числа. Теперь нам нужно возвести полученное число в квадрат:

    • 123² = 15129.

Таким образом, для примера с числами 1, 2, 3, квадрат числа 123 будет равен 15129.

Примерный алгоритм решения задачи:

  1. Считываем три случайных числа (например, с помощью генератора случайных чисел или вводим их вручную).
  2. Объединяем эти числа в одно (можно сделать это с помощью конкатенации строк).
  3. Преобразуем полученную строку в целое число.
  4. Вычисляем квадрат этого числа.
  5. Выводим результат.

Пример кода на Python:

python
# Шаг 1: генерируем случайные значения кубика import random

a = random.randint(1, 6) b = random.randint(1, 6) c = random.randint(1, 6)

# Шаг 2: формируем число из трёх выпадений number = int(str(a) + str(b) + str(c))

# Шаг 3: находим квадрат числа square = number ** 2

# Шаг 4: выводим результат print(f"Число: {number}") print(f"Его квадрат: {square}")

В результате программа выведет число, составленное из трёх бросков кубика, и его квадрат.

Похожие вопросы

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ос